Responsibilities:

  • Prepare and operate complex EP lab equipment
  • Assist physicians during electrophysiological studies, ablations, and device implants
  • Monitor patients before, during, and after procedures
  • Perform and document imaging and procedural data accurately
  • Maintain strict adherence to safety and infection control protocols
  • Stay current with latest advances and practices in electrophysiology imaging
